Well I've read all the e-Dist posts I can find and I really think we are very very close to getting the e-Dist to work with my Oddfire SpeedPro box but we need to do one of the following things. Either 1) Send the SpeedPro box back to FAST and have them set the cam sync input set to read Hall Effect signals which we will get from a 96+ Vortec distributor, or 2) Find a convertor which can turn an Magnetic inductive pickup signal into a Hall Effect signal. I guess my only question is, is there such a convertor readily available? I've done some searching but I haven't found anything. I'd rather not send my ECU back to FAST if I don't have to. Originally posted by OddfireV6
Find a convertor which can turn an Magnetic inductive pickup signal into a Hall Effect signal. I guess my only question is, is there such a convertor readily available? I've done some searching but I haven't found anything.


To convert a VR (mag pick-up) AC signal into a square-wave (Hall) signal, you can use the LM 1815 chip. It takes a VR input, and has a transistor output on pin 12 (IIRC) with the transistor turning 'on' when the reluctor is directly over the mag pick-up. http://www.national.com/ds/LM/LM1815.pdf

If you don't want to build the circuit, I think you can also use a standard GM 7 or 8-pin HEI module to get the VR input, and then take the square wave output off the DRP ref pin. Not sure if that helps, but I think it answers the Q.
